It is such a nice feeling that Mu is such a capable little language ๐Ÿ˜… And I decided to write code code in Mu by hand ๐Ÿคš haha ๐Ÿคฃ and start solving Project Euler problems, like Problem 8 which works out to be a nice elegant solution in Mu:

#!/usr/bin/env mu

// Largest Product in a Series

import "fp"
import "sys"

fn usage() {
  print("Usage: cat |", args()[0], "<n>")
}

fn products(xs) {
  return fp.reduce(xs, 1, fn(x, y) {
    if y == nil {
      return x
    }
    return x * y
  })
}

fn main() {
  if len(args()) < 2 {
    usage()
    exit(1)
  }

  s := must(sys.read_all(0))
  if len(s) == 0 {
    usage()
    exit(1)
  }

  n := must(int(args()[1]))
  r := fp.max(fp.map(fp.sliding(fp.map(s, int), n), products))
  print(r)
}

main()
